What usually determines when and how much fine artist get paid?

The pay of fine artists is usually determined by factors such as the size and complexity of the artwork, the artist's reputation and demand, and the purpose of the artwork.

The pay of fine artists is usually determined by several factors. One important factor is the size and complexity of the artwork. Artists may charge more for larger and more intricate pieces because they require more time and materials to create. Another factor is the artist's reputation and demand for their work. Well-known artists with a strong following may be able to command higher prices for their pieces. Additionally, the purpose of the artwork can also affect the pay. Art made for commercial purposes, such as advertisements, may have different payment structures compared to fine art created for galleries and museums.
